As a new Tate exhibition of paintings puts the work of Swedish painter Hilma af Klint alongside modernist giant, Piet Mondrian. Both were painters fascinated by esoteric and occult ideas that became more marginal with the ascendancy of modernism. Matthew Sweet and guests discuss these abstract art works, theosophy and a search for the spirit world.Nabila Abdel Nabi is co-curator of Hilma Af Klint & Piet Mondrian: Forms of Life runs at Tate Modern in LondonJennifer Higgie is the author of The Other Side: A Journey into Women, Art and the Spirit WorldDaniel Birnbaum is a Swedish art curator and an art critic. Since 2019, he has been director and curator of Acute Art in LondonSarah Kent is an art criticProducer: Ruth WattsHilma Af Klint & Piet Mondrian: Forms of Life runs at Tate Modern in London from April 20 - September 3 2023
